## Account Recovery — Pylon Relay

If a locked account blocks websocket reconnects, disable permessage-deflate first: compression saves roughly 40% bandwidth on Pylon Relay but triples CPU during recovery storms, which delays session restoration. Re-enable it only after the queue drains. To unlock the recovery console and restart the handshake service, use the passphrase listed directly below.

unlock words, bahop-fawef: novmir-druwyn-soriel-rusdor-kasion

Runbook fragment 4.2 — Archiving paper ledgers. Before dispatch, confirm each ledger box is sealed with numbered tamper tape and recorded on the manifest held by the Thornaby Archive desk. The coordinator assigns one driver per run; no shared loads with general freight. On arrival at the Kelverton depot, the driver must not release the boxes to general staff. The driver is to carry out the confidential hand-over step stated immediately below.

handover note for tafog-bawef: the ulair kasael courier leaves the ralok gilmir fenael druwyn feneth queniel belix keliel ledger at gate 5216 under passcode 961436

Step 2 — offline mode. Update the Fernline Survey app to build 4.x. Offline queue replaces the old draft cache; drafts do not migrate, so sync before upgrading. Conflict resolution is last-write-wins per field. Verify the sync daemon starts on launch. Point your build at the staging backend using the values below.

service settings:
novath:
  pin: 1396
  tenant: pelys
  seal: seal_ccc035e1
  metrics_host: metrics.novath.qorvelworks.test
  standby_team: fraeth
  escalation: drueth-zorok
  nonce: 61d508